Donna J.
Gallant
Counsel
Donna Gallant provides employment and labour law advice to management across a broad range of industry sectors. She works with employers on a day-to-day basis to develop, implement and update their human resource policies and practices, and to resolve workplace issues quickly as they arise. She represents employers in wrongful dismissal litigation, grievance arbitrations, and claims pursuant to human rights, employment standards, and workers' compensation legislation. Donna frequently provides advice on employment and labour issues in the context of corporate reorganizations, mergers and acquisitions.
Donna's experience includes:
- Employer counsel in human rights cases, wrongful dismissal litigation, grievance arbitrations
- Employer representative in workers' compensation cases
- Advising on labour and employment issues in context of mergers and acquisitions
- Assisting employers to negotiate terms of severance in the context of individual terminations
- Assisting employers to implement mass layoffs, downsizings and plant closures
- Advising employers in the conduct of investigations of harassment, theft, and drug use
- Advising employers in the negotiation and drafting of executive employment agreements
Donna articled with the firm in 1983 and became a partner in 1990. In 1993 Donna took a leave of absence from practice to focus on family and volunteer interests. In 1997, she accepted a position as in house counsel and corporate secretary for a public company, where she practiased until her return to the firm in 2004.
